
Liverpool earned a 2-1 victory over Tottenham Hotspur in the third round of the Carabao Cup at Anfield. The hosts took control during the first half when Alexis Mac Allister found the net in the 21st minute, establishing a lead that held through the interval.
Cody Gakpo subsequently doubled the advantage for the home side by striking nine minutes into the second half.
Tottenham managed to reduce the deficit in the 69th minute courtesy of a Conor Gallagher finish. Despite the late push and the contest continuing through extra time, Liverpool held on to their edge to secure the win.
